WindowBlinds 3.50a may have "expired" (workaround: turn clock back)

WindowBlinds 3.50a may have "expired" (workaround: turn clock back)

This is an advance warning - if anyone here is using WB 3.5a and has sudden problems, you may be experiencing an unforseen expiry condition in this build of WB. Stardock personnel aren't around right now, but when they are, they'll fix it. If you're experiencing problems (eg unskinned windows, rundll warnings), don't panic!

For now just sit tight and maybe unload WB. You can also try turning the clock back, early indications show that this "fixes" it.
